Taxi from the Airport

Official taxi stands are usually located at the airport exits, clearly marked. It is advisable to agree on the fare with the driver before getting into the taxi, or to make sure the taximeter is turned on. A taxi to the city center usually takes 15-30 minutes, depending on traffic. The cost of a taxi can be around 15-30 EUR.

Private Transfer

A private transfer can be pre-booked, which can be especially useful if you are traveling with a larger group or have a lot of luggage. Most providers will be waiting for you in the airport arrivals hall with a sign displaying your name. It is important to confirm the meeting point after booking and to check that the driver knows your flight number. The price of a private transfer usually ranges between 30-60 EUR, depending on the type of vehicle and the distance.

Shared Transfer and Minibus

A shared transfer can be a cost-effective solution if you are not in a hurry and do not mind sharing the vehicle with other travelers. These services usually operate on a schedule and stop at multiple locations. The travel time may be longer than with a taxi or private transfer, but the price is usually between 10-20 EUR.

Public Transportation

You can also reach the city center from Cluj International Airport by local buses. This is the cheapest solution, but the journey time is longer and may require several transfers. The bus stop is located near the airport, and the ticket price is a few EUR. The train station is also accessible, but the bus is usually a more convenient option.

The travel time to the city center and the costs may vary depending on the time of day, traffic and the chosen mode of transport. During peak hours, traffic can slow down traffic, especially in the morning and evening.

Mode of Transport Duration (approx.) Price (EUR, approx.)
Taxi 15-30 minutes 15-30
Private transfer 20-40 minutes 30-60
Shared transfer 30-60 minutes 10-20
Public transport (bus) 45-90 minutes 2-5

Duration and prices may vary depending on traffic and the season.
